Accounting for Displacement: The Hidden Factor


One typical mistake novices make is presuming that a 200-litre tank holds 200 litres of water. In reality, it holds less. This inconsistency is due to displacement.

Every item placed inside the aquarium pushes water out of the method. Therefore, the real water volume is lower than the calculated glass volume. Factors that decrease total water volume include:

How to Estimate Displacement

While calculating the precise displacement of every rock and pebble is laborious, aquarists can typically approximate that decors, substrate, and empty area decrease overall tank volume by approximately 10% to 15%.

For instance, a tank determined geometrically to hold 200 litres will likely hold closer to 175 to 180 litres of actual water once fully decorated. When dosing potent medications, it is always much safer to calculate based on this a little minimized water volume to prevent unintentional overdosing.

Step-by-Step Guide: How to Calculate Your Tank's Volume


Follow these basic steps to discover the true water capability of any basic aquarium:

  1. Measure the Interior: Use a measuring tape to discover the inside length, width, and height of the glass. Determining the inside avoids considering the density of the glass walls.
  2. Convert Units: Ensure all measurements are in centimetres.
  3. Apply the Formula: Multiply Length ₤ \ times ₤ Width ₤ \ times ₤ Height, then divide the resulting number by 1,000 to get litres.
  4. Subtract for Substrate and Decor: Estimate the space used up by gravel and rocks, and deduct approximately 10% from the last number to discover the actual water volume.
  5. Alternative Method (The Bucket Test): For irregularly shaped or custom tanks, the most precise method to discover volume is to fill the tank utilizing a container of a known size (such as a 10-litre pail) and keep a tally of how numerous containers it requires to fill the aquarium.
